Color washing is an easy and forgiving form of faux finishing often used by beginners, but perfected by professional finishers. It creates a pretty look and is super fun to play around with. Color washing involves diluting a solid matte paint in water and brushing it onto an absorbent surface—the end result is a soft, muted finish that's perfect for adding rustic elegance to plain decor.
